#b17c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b17c72 is composed of 69.4% red, 48.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.9%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 9.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 57.1%. #b17c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8e4 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#b17c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b17c72 has RGB values of R:177, G:124,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.36,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11631730.

Shades and Tints of #b17c72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0706 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b17c72
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988d8b is the less saturated color, while #fd4826 is the most saturated one.
